MADAM, The Programme for Government update published by the Labour government this week glosses over its failures and paints an inaccurate picture of Labour's performance. On health, there is no mention of Labour's failure to meet ambulance response time targets, cancer treatment waiting time targets, or diagnostic test waiting time targets. On education, there is no mention of Labour's failure to make progress in closing the attainment gap. On the economy, there is no mention of Labour's failure to bring down long-term youth unemployment, to create high quality work or to close the GVA gap. We are facing a tired Labour Government that has run out of steam. Plaid Cymru's focus now is on health, education and the economy. Wales has the ability and capacity as a nation to run these services effectively. Leanne Wood (Plaid Cymru leader)
